概括
当地政府支出结构影响美国人口健康. 更集中的县支出减少了社区中年死亡率的差异,突出了政府结构.

背景情况:
- 地方政府支出的差异与美国各地人口健康结果的变化有关.
- 除了支出水平之外,地方政府财政的结构也可能影响健康不平等.
研究的目的:
- 调查地方政府支出的集中是否会影响工作年龄死亡率的空间变化,独立于总支出金额.
- 探索历史和政治因素对地方政府结构的影响,以及它们对人口健康的影响.
主要方法:
- 分析地方政府财政数据和美国人口普查地区的死亡率统计数据.
- 统计建模以评估财政集中和死亡率变化之间的关系,控制总支出.
主要成果:
- 地方政府支出的集中度更高,县政府占比更大,与人口普查区域中中年死亡率的变化减少有关.
- 这一发现甚至在考虑了地方政府支出总额后也是如此.
结论:
- 地方政府财政制度的结构,特别是集中程度,在塑造人口健康的地域差异方面发挥着重要作用.
- 了解这些政府结构对于解决健康不平等至关重要,即使这些结构不是政治辩论的主要主题.
